Update linupx-scripts.sh
This commit is contained in:
@@ -372,6 +372,26 @@ SPEEDTEST_INSTALL() {
|
|||||||
read -n 1 -s -p "Press any key to continue";;
|
read -n 1 -s -p "Press any key to continue";;
|
||||||
esac
|
esac
|
||||||
}
|
}
|
||||||
|
URBACKUP_INSTALL() {
|
||||||
|
read -n 1 -p "Are you sure you wish to install Urbackup Client (Y/n)?" choice
|
||||||
|
case "$choice" in
|
||||||
|
[Nn]) INSTALL_MENU;;
|
||||||
|
* )
|
||||||
|
echo ""
|
||||||
|
|
||||||
|
read -n 1 -p "Enter ClientID:" clientid
|
||||||
|
read -n 1 -p "Enter Auth Key:" authkey
|
||||||
|
|
||||||
|
TF=`mktemp` && wget "http://urbackup.scity.us:55414/x?a=download_client&lang=en&clientid=${clientid}&authkey=${authkey}&os=linux" -O $TF && sudo sh $TF; rm -f $TF
|
||||||
|
|
||||||
|
echo ""
|
||||||
|
echo -e "${Green}UrBackup Client has been Installed${Color_Off}"
|
||||||
|
echo ""
|
||||||
|
echo -e "${LightCyan}To run, use the command: speedtest${Color_Off}"
|
||||||
|
if [ ${action-x} ]; then exit 0; fi
|
||||||
|
read -n 1 -s -p "Press any key to continue";;
|
||||||
|
esac
|
||||||
|
}
|
||||||
X11VNC_INSTALL() {
|
X11VNC_INSTALL() {
|
||||||
read -n 1 -p "Are you sure you wish to install x11vnc (Y/n)?" choice
|
read -n 1 -p "Are you sure you wish to install x11vnc (Y/n)?" choice
|
||||||
case "$choice" in
|
case "$choice" in
|
||||||
@@ -550,6 +570,8 @@ INSTALL_MENU() {
|
|||||||
echo ""
|
echo ""
|
||||||
echo " [9] Install .bashrc for root"
|
echo " [9] Install .bashrc for root"
|
||||||
echo ""
|
echo ""
|
||||||
|
echo " [U] Install UrBackup Client"
|
||||||
|
echo ""
|
||||||
echo " [0] Remove LinUPx"
|
echo " [0] Remove LinUPx"
|
||||||
echo ""
|
echo ""
|
||||||
echo " [B] Back to Update Scripts"
|
echo " [B] Back to Update Scripts"
|
||||||
@@ -580,6 +602,8 @@ INSTALL_MENU() {
|
|||||||
INSTALL_MENU;;
|
INSTALL_MENU;;
|
||||||
0) LINUPX_UNINSTALL
|
0) LINUPX_UNINSTALL
|
||||||
INSTALL_MENU;;
|
INSTALL_MENU;;
|
||||||
|
[Uu]) URBACKUP_INSTALL
|
||||||
|
INSTALL_MENU;;
|
||||||
[Bb]) SCRIPT_MENU;;
|
[Bb]) SCRIPT_MENU;;
|
||||||
[Qq]) EXIT1
|
[Qq]) EXIT1
|
||||||
exit 1;;
|
exit 1;;
|
||||||
|
|||||||
Reference in New Issue
Block a user